Weight reduction: 7 Steamed Indian Dishes For Guilt-Free Munching
 
1. Idli: (Most Famous)
 
Dissimilar to the greater part of our Indian bites, these idlis are not seared in swelling oil or slathered with margarine. Since the oil content in idli is so less, the calorie admission is likewise generally low. This makes idli a preferred option over seared pakodas or samosas. Aside from this, since idli is matured, it is not difficult to process. Eating matured food empowers a superior breakdown of minerals and nutrients in our body, which helps in absorption.
 
2. Dhokla: (Most Recommended)
 
Dhokla is a steamed tidbit made with a besan player. Steaming assists you with saving an incredible number of calories. Since it isn't broiled, it is additionally coming up short on cholesterol. The player for this dhokla is made with chana dal, which is a superb wellspring of plant-based protein. Notwithstanding chana dal, the player additionally has yogurt, which is likewise a decent wellspring of protein and calcium.
 
 
3. Dal Farra:
 
A flavorful North Indian dal dumpling that you should attempt, this dal farra can be delighted in for lunch or a speedy nibble quickly, or made on exceptional events. These steamed dumplings have a punch of flavor to them, on account of the delectable blend of dal that is utilized for the stuffing. Normally made with chana, urad and matar dal, the farra does extraordinary on both wellbeing and flavor remainder.
 
4. Uppu Urundai:
 
Uppu Urundai is a gently flavored steamed rice ball, tempered with mustard seeds, jeera seeds, chana and urad dal and curry leaves. Likewise called neer urundai, it is a quarrel free formula that can be ready in under 30 minutes. You can appreciate uppu urundai as breakfast or for evening snacks.
 

 
 

5. Siddu:
 
Siddu is an exemplary Himachali steamed bun that generally incorporates maida, yeast, ghee and salt for setting up the bread batter; in any case, you can supplant the maida with atta for making it a piece better. Loaded down with various sweet or appetizing fillings, Siddu can be appreciated as breakfast or evening nibble. This hot and steaming ameliorating bun is best matched with some masala tea.
 
6. Patholi:
 
Patholi is a steamed sweet dish that is made during celebrations in Mangalore and its adjoining regions. Turmeric leaf is an absolute necessity have in your storeroom in the event that you are attempting to make valid patholi. What's more, similar as haldi powder, the leaf likewise adds a few wellbeing helping properties to the formula. It is made by spreading a sweet glue made from rice, parched coconut, jaggery, and cardamom powder on the leaf.
 
7. Beans Kudumulu:
 
Kudumulu are Andhra-style steamed rice cakes that are like modak. These can be made sweet or exquisite. These beans kudumulu are made of wide beans, rice flour and a few basic tempered south Indian flavors. These delicate steamed cakes taste incredible with coconut chutney or garlic chutney. The Andhra-style kudumulu is a fast and solid finger food that will be adored by children and grown-ups, the same.
